Artist Spotlight: Women in Music - Tracy Melon
Tracy Melon is quickly emerging as one of Uganda’s most exciting young musical talents, blending rich vocals with a versatile sound that cuts across multiple genres. Born Tracy Mirembe on 10th May 2001 in Iganga and raised in Mutungo, Kampala, she has grown into a dynamic singer, songwriter, and performer whose artistry reflects both her roots and global influences. Artist Spotlight: Women in Music Nkosazana Daughter
Nkosazana Daughter has rapidly become one of the most recognizable and soulful voices in the Amapiano scene. Known for her ethereal vocals and emotionally rich delivery , she has carved out a unique space in South Africa’s thriving music industry. Rising to prominence through collaborations with top producers and DJs, her sound blends traditional African influences with contemporary Amapiano rhythms, making her music both deeply rooted and globally appealing. Hyperlocal Spotlight: Rachel Magoola and the Future of Buganda Sounds
Ugandan music icon Rachel Magoola has long been celebrated for her powerful voice and dedication to cultural heritage. As a leading member of Afrigo Band and a respected cultural advocate, Magoola has used her platform to champion the preservation of traditional Buganda sounds. Artist Spotlight: The Power of Women in Music - Guchi
Ugochi Onuoha , popularly known as Guchi , is a Nigerian singer, songwriter, recording artiste, and performer making waves in the Afropop scene. Known for her distinctive voice and emotionally rich lyrics, Guchi has quickly carved a space for herself in the competitive Nigerian music industry.
